Signs and symptoms
ADHD can cause a variety of symptoms. It can cause a short-term attention span, trouble staying organized and focused, forgetfulness, and difficulties prioritising. It can also cause problems with self-esteem, relationships, and also working performance. ADHD is an inherited condition, and it can affect anyone of any age. There are a variety of methods for managing the symptoms, including medications.

An ADHD assessment will begin with a screening appointment that lasts up to 1.5 hours. The assessment will cover your personal information, developmental history, as well as your current issues. You will be asked to fill out a series questionnaires. You will also be asked to fill out a SNappD survey, which assesses the quality of your sleeping and the effect that poor sleep has on your symptoms.
A face-toface consultation with a psychiatrist is the final step in an adhd assessment for adults leicester (super fast reply) assessment. This appointment typically lasts 60 minutes and includes a comprehensive medical examination of your mental health. Your psychiatrist will give you a diagnosis and provide you with treatment options based upon the findings.

ADHD is characterized by difficulties in focusing on a task or staying focused. Other signs include difficulty in organising tasks or activities, making frequent mistakes, and having difficulty remembering details. Some people suffering from adhd assessment for adults near me can also have difficulty regulating their emotions. This can make it difficult to deal with stress in the day.
ADHD can also cause impulse-driven behaviors, like an over-reaction to events that are minor. These reactions can lead to strained relationships, difficulties at work or in school and financial issues. Many people who suffer from ADHD have trouble getting their attention on their goals and tend to procrastinate. In addition, they often struggle to complete simple tasks like cleaning or paying bills.
Environmental factors can also trigger or exacerbate ADHD. Genetics can play a role in its development, but there are other elements that could be involved. These factors include exposure to toxins in pregnancy, smoking or alcohol abuse in the early years of childhood, and trauma in childhood. Certain types of brain injury can also lead to the onset of ADHD symptoms or an aggravation.

Typically, the first step to get an ADHD assessment is to contact your GP and request a referral. It may take a while for the referral to be processed and for a session to be scheduled with psychiatrist. But it's worth it as the results could be a major change to your life.
The assessment process for ADHD for adults will require an initial screening appointment that lasts up to 1.5 hours. The screening will be conducted by a psychiatrist, and could include questionnaire measures. It will also include a neurodevelopmental general screen, meaning that both ASD and ADHD can be identified.
If an assessment slot becomes available and you are contacted by the provider and asked to make an appointment for an appointment. You will be asked to provide pertinent medical records as well in a brief description of your mental health. You will meet with an expert psychiatrist for a face-to-face appointment which usually lasts for 60 minutes. In this session the psychiatrist will evaluate your mental health and collect an entire psychiatric history.
